The micro lending market size in North America, specifically in the United States and Canada, is witnessing significant growth due to the increasing demand for small loans among individuals and small businesses. In the U.S., the market is driven by the presence of a large number of micro-lending institutions and favorable regulatory environment. Canada is also experiencing growth in the micro lending sector, with an increasing number of borrowers turning to micro lenders for quick and easy access to credit.
Asia Pacific:
In Asia Pacific, countries like China, Japan, and South Korea are witnessing a boom in the micro lending market. In China, the market is growing rapidly due to the rise of online lending platforms and the increasing demand for credit among individuals and small businesses. Japan and South Korea are also seeing growth in the micro lending sector, driven by technological advancements and changing consumer behavior.
Europe:
In Europe, the micro lending market is thriving in countries like the United Kingdom, Germany, and France. The U.K. has a well-established micro lending sector, with a large number of financial institutions offering small loans to individuals and businesses. Germany and France are also experiencing growth in the micro lending market, with the increasing popularity of peer-to-peer lending platforms and the growing demand for alternative sources of credit.
